AMG Has a New Super Sedan. Here’s What It’ll Look Like


Sometime next month, Mercedes-AMG will reveal its replacement for the GT 4-Door Coupe. We saw a shadowy teaser previewing the car’s silhouette, but new images provide a clearer look at the unnamed model.

It appears the new Mercedes will ditch the GT’s liftback design for a traditional trunk. There’s a clear body line separating the rear glass and the camouflaged rear spoiler, but it’s hard to know for sure until we see the real thing. It looks like a long, large car with flush door handles, massive multi-spoke wheels, and a coupe-like roof.

The AMG also appears to have a hood that opens, possibly revealing a front trunk. It’s tough to tell if the rear taillights are real units or decoys, but the headlights look like they’re production-ready daytime running lights.

The new model will ride on the brand’s AMG.EA platform, which is supposed to result in fun-to-drive electric vehicles. There’ll be an SUV equivalent, with the two using YASA’s axial-flux motors—lightweight e-motors that can deliver up to 480 horsepower and 590 pound-feet of torque. 

We still expect the car to weight quite a bit, though, which could affect how it handles. The AMG 4-Door GT plug-in hybrid with the V-8 weighs 5,269 pounds. That’s heavier than a 2024 Land Rover Range Rover Sport and nearly as heavy as a Chevrolet Tahoe. 

The new car will have two electric motors, giving the sedan close to 1,000 horsepower and over 1,000 pound-feet of torque. However, it’s unclear if Mercedes will put one on each axle, giving it all-wheel drive, or attach both to the rear for maximum chaos. We say, why not both?
